ISBN: 1556221762 ISBN-13: 9781556221767 Publisher: Taylor Trade Publishing OUR PRICE: $10.40 Product Type: Paperback - Other Formats Published: December 1991 Annotation: In the beginning it was happy trails. Then some dummy invented the horseless carraige and things haven't been the same since. As ribbons of concrete spread over the horse trails, so did the fun and frustration. This book explores some of that highway fun, both past and present. Included are unique pictures of strange vehicles, early gas stations, convenience stores, the evolutions of the stop light, unusual roadside signs, the Texas billboard hall of fame, unusual accidents, strange things seen when driving, and much, much more. |
